MNF Rams vs. Cardinals Wild Card Top Anytime TD Bets
Van Jefferson (+260)
The Cardinals have not been able to slow down wide receivers for the entire second half of the season. Overshadowed by the addition of Odell Beckham, Jefferson has still played over 90 percent of snaps as the Rams run 3-wide among the most in the NFL. The Cardinals allowed a league-high 26 scores to opposing wide receivers, four more than the next worst team! For what it's worth Van scored in each game against the Cardinals earlier this season.
Odell Beckham Jr. (+160)
I know I just talked about how Jefferson is overshadowed by this man but all he's done since joining the Rams is produce. He's scored in five of the last seven games with the Rams this season. In a perfect world, both he and Van score on Monday night but at least one of them will and we will profit. Eighty percent of the Rams' touchdowns come through the air, and 75% of the TDs allowed by the Cards' defense are via the pass. I have more faith in the Rams offense at home and I'm expecting both teams to be throwing quite often on Monday night.
Zach Ertz (+260)
The Rams allow the most yards per short pass among playoff teams, something that fits into the wheelhouse of Ertz. He has seen an end zone target in three straight games and a red zone target in five straight. Ertz has received multiple red zone targets in three of those five games. Since Hopkins has been out, Ertz has emerged as Kyler Murray's favorite target. He has averaged 11 targets per game since Hopkins' injury. These looks haven't translated into touchdowns but that is likely to change on Monday night. The Rams have one of the best run-stopping units in the NFL and I expect them to be ahead in the game on Monday night, forcing the Cardinals to throw. Cooper Kupp to Score 2 (+380)
I thought about this one long and hard and we're locking this one in. It just makes sense. I really don't love betting a guy to score two touchdowns at these odds but it works for this situation. Kupp is -125 at Bet365 and there's just no value there. If Stafford refuses to look at Jefferson there's a great chance of this one cashing. If all three Rams wide receivers just score once then we're still up about a half a unit. I just told you how awful the Cardinals have been keeping wide receivers out of the end zone. I'll repeat the fact that 80% of the Rams' touchdowns come through the air, and 75% of the TDs allowed by the Cards' defense are via the pass. Kupp finished with fewer than 90 receiving yards on just one occasion in the regular season. He scored 16 total touchdowns on the season and multiple touchdowns in five games. Arizona's defense has been horrible to close out the season, allowing 354 total yards per game over their past five, and opponents are scoring on 53% of their possessions. In Week 14 at Arizona, Kupp logged a 50% target share, his highest rate of the season. That included five red zone targets and two end zone targets. In Week 4 against Arizona, he saw 31.7% of the Rams targets -- his highest in any Rams loss this season. The worst-case scenario is the Cardinals game plan to slow down Kupp but then I'll expect Jefferson and OBJ to capitalize.
